Significance of namaste

In Hindu culture , we always greet others saying Namaste that is by Joining both palms together to greet.

“NAMASTE”. The traditional Indian greeting. A gesture which marks respect reverence and love for the person we great. So why do we greet people in this way?

 In yoga this gesture is called Anjali mudra. What is a well known fact that tips of the finger are major energy points. When we bring together the palms of our fingers linking the tips of the fingers, then don't nerve circuits of the brain a link to those of the upper body. A feeling of calmness and well being immediately decends.

 Also in yoga each finger is representative of a certain energy. The little finger represent Tamas or dullness, the ring finger represent rajas or activity, the middle finger represent satwa aur refinement, the index finger is the individual soul or jeevatma and the term is the paramatma for the ultimate soul. These are the reasons behind namaste the traditional Indian greeting.
